Why Pray?
Prayer is powerful. It activates our faith and strengthens our relationship with God. The habit of prayer helps us to deepen our dependence on him and it shapes our perspective to be more like his. It opens us to what God wants to do in our lives. There is no skill level or experience required to pray. We all can approach God with our requests, our gratitude, and our concerns knowing that he is capable of doing far more than we could ask or imagine.
Week 1: Hunger for God
Thank God for being the one who fills our deepest hunger.
"Blessed are those who hunger and thirst for righteousness, for they will be filled". Matthew 5:6 Ask God to stir spiritual hunger in every heart.
Pray for greater intimacy with God.
"I keep asking that the God of our Lord Jesus Christ, the glorious Father, may give you the spirit of wisdom and revelation, so that you may know him better". Ephesians 1:17
Prayer
"God, we want more of You. Stir up our hunger to know You. Help us desire Your presence more than anything else."
Family Activity
Write your family's prayer requests and tape them on the fridge or wall.
Week 2: Pruning + Priorities
Clearing Space for God to Move
“I am the true vine, and my Father is the gardener. 2 He cuts off every branch in me that bears no fruit, while every branch that does bear fruit he prunes so that it will be even more fruitful". John 15:1–2 Ask God for clarity to cut back what’s crowding out God.
Pray for Jesus to Take His Place
"I keep asking that the God of our Lord Jesus Christ, the glorious Father, may give you the spirit of wisdom and revelation, so that you may know him better". Ephesians 1:17
Prayer
"Lord, we dedicate our home to You. Let it be a place where Your name is honored and where Your Spirit is welcome."
Family Activity
Take a House Prayer Tour! 🏠 Grab your family and walk room to room, praying together as you go. Bless the spaces where you live, laugh, rest, and gather. From the kitchen to the closet, invite God into every corner of your home!
